1670941486006650 is an even composite number. It is composed of seven dist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of two thousand, two hundred sixty-eight divisors.

Prime factorization of 1670941486006650:

2 × 36 × 52 × 112 × 132 × 172 × 7757

(2 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 5 × 5 × 11 × 11 × 13 × 13 × 17 × 17 × 7757)
